Bankmed, Stop Confusing CSR With Charity!

Bankmed, Stop Confusing CSR With Charity!

Early in January, Bankmed announced that, as part of its CSR initiatives, the bank chose “to replace its end-of-year Corporate Gifts by donations to seven Lebanese NGOs, granting each one an amount of USD 30,000 [for a total of $210,000].”

Half the world's schools lack clean water, toilets and handwashing

Half the world's schools lack clean water, toilets and handwashing

LONDON (Thomson Reuters Foundation) - Nearly half the world’s schools lack clean drinking water, toilets and handwashing facilities, putting millions of children at risk of disease, experts warned on Monday.
